État de la populationExpert
During an observation in May 2008, when the species was not yet described, c.280 mature individuals were observed and most of them were found in an area of 4 km², whereas in the other half of the area of occupancy, which is separated from the first one by the Black Drin River, less than one fourth of the individuals were found. The monitoring of mature individuals in May 2010 showed a decline of the population with 200 mature individuals, but the observation in May 2013, shows an increase with 260 mature individuals in total. The generation length for the species is three years.

It is likely that the population declined after construction of a dam downstream, but there is no information on this. However a decline in population on the serpentine is suspected to have occurred since mining was observed in 2013.

Description complète des menacesExpert
The major threat to the species is the natural succession of vegetation, covering the clearings among the woody scrub. We suspect that the species is very adaptable to shady conditions. Excessive grazing by sheep and cattle, which was observed during the spring and summer. In 2013, mining for chromium on the serpentine rocks was observed which impacts the habitat of the subpopulation on the serpentine substrate.

Mesures de conservation recommandéesExpert
The area where the species occurs and the species itself are not protected by the Albanian law. There is a clear need for monitoring and protecting the species. Protection of the site where the species occurs is needed also because the locality is an important areas for several Albanian endemics, relict species and species endemic to the Balkans. The creation of small clearings between the scrubs can help increase the population size. The species was assessed as Critically Endangered for Albania (MEA 2013).
